Tiago APOLONIA wants to do better

The beginning of the year offers high quality table tennis events all over the globe, as usual. With club’s season reaching climax, the tournaments are also on top player’s agenda. Before the 2015 NN Table Tennis Club ITTF – Europe Top 16 in Baku at the beginning of the February, European Champions League reached semi final stage. Among quarterfinalists was Tiago APOLONIA’S 1 FC Saarbrucken. They lost against Gazproma Orenburg.

“I travel a lot lately and we have a lot of matches. I do not have time for special preparations for Baku,” stated APOLONIA.

Maybe he will not have special preparations but he will have a chance to see main adversaries on duty. Dimitrij OVTCHAROV and Vladimir SAMSONOV played for winning team, Orenburg, in last weekend’s ECL quarters against German club. For Saarbrucken also played Adrien MATTENET. Like APOLONIA, French player also failed to score against Russia’s giants.

“In Saarbrucken I lost against OVTCHAROV. It was a good game. He is in good shape. On the other side I had some minor injuries which prevented me from playing at highest level. Most important thing is that I feel good now and I hope to be at top shape in Baku.”

APOLONIA will play for a third time at Top 16. “That is most prestigious tournament in Europe and I like the playing format. So far, my best result is quarterfinal. I reached it last year in Lausanne. I hope for better this season,” stated Tiago APOLONIA.
